LORD OF THE FLIES My report is about the very well known book "Lord of the flies", by William Golding. There are many characters in this book, but the most important ones are Ralph, Jack, Simon, Piggy, and Roger. When I read this book I discovered a great change in most of their personalities, especially Jack's. So I would say that they are all dynamic characters. Ralph, in the beginning of the novel, had a boyish personality. Then later on in the novel, he became much more mature due to the fact that all of them had to live in a more civilized manner to get a long and to survive while waiting to be rescued. Jack, in the beginning of the novel was Ralph's most powerful antagonist. Then later on turned against Ralph and becomes leader. Simon is a unique character in the novel. He remains largely uninvolved with any of the power struggles between Ralph and Jack. He was killed. Roger is very mean. He killed Piggy by pushing a big bolder on top of him. Piggy was the intellectual in the group. He complained a lot in the beginning, but later on became more mature. But, unfortunately, he was killed by Roger. The novel begins about a group of English people who are marooned on a tropical island when the plane evacuating them from atomic war-torn England crashes. So now this group of boys are alone on this island. Then Ralph called an assembly to talk to the other guys about making a plan to get along and survive. The struggle starts in trying to make rules for the group to live by. There were many more conflicts through out the novel.
